The common flat pack IC packages are QFP (Quad Flat Package), TQFP (Thin Quad Flat Package), STQFP (Small Thin Quad Plastic Flat Package), FQFP (Fine-pitch Quad Flat Package), HQFP (Quad Flat Package with Heat sink), LQFP (Low profile Quad Flat Package), VQFP (Very-small Quad Flat Package), MQFP (Metric Quad Flat Package), BQFP (Bumper quad flat-pack), ETQFP (Exposed thin quad flat-package), PQFN (Power quad flat-pack), PQFP (Plastic quad flat-package), QFJ (Quad Flat J-leaded package), QFN (Quad Flat Non-leaded package), TQFN (Thin-Quad Flat No-Lead Plastic package), DFN (Dual Flat package), QFI (Quad Flat I-leaded package), HVQFN (Heat-sink very-thin quad flat-pack, no-leads), VQFN (Very-thin quad flat, no-lead), WQFN (Very-very-thin quad flat, no-lead), UQFN (Ultra-thin quad flat-pack, no-lead), and ODFN (Optical dual flat, no-lead). A quad flat package (QFP) is a surface-mounted integrated circuit package with "gull wing" leads extending from each of the four sides. The common dual-inline packages are DIP (Dual In-line Package), SDIP (Shrink Dual In-line), CDIP (Ceramic Dual In-line), CER-DIP (Glass-sealed Ceramic DIP), PDIP (Plastic DIP), SKDIP (Skinny DIP), WDIP (Dual In-line with Window Package), and MDIP (Molded DIP). The common chip-scale packages are CSP (Chip-scale package), TCSP (True chip-size package), TDSP (True die-size package), WCSP/WL-CSP/WLCSP (Wafer-level chip-scale package), PMCP (Power mount CSP), Fan-out WLCSP (Fan-out wafer-level packaging), eWLB (Embedded wafer level ball grid array), COB (Chip on board), COF (Chip-on-flex), COG (Chip-on-glass), COW (Chip on wire), TAB (Tape-automated bonding), and MICRO SMD.
